mc2lib
mc2lib::memconsistency::cats::ArchProxy< ConcreteArch > Member List

This is the complete list of members for mc2lib::memconsistency::cats::ArchProxy< ConcreteArch >, including all inherited members.

arch_mc2lib::memconsistency::cats::ArchProxy< ConcreteArch >protected
Architecture()mc2lib::memconsistency::cats::Architectureinline
ArchProxy(ConcreteArch *arch)mc2lib::memconsistency::cats::ArchProxy< ConcreteArch >inlineexplicit
Clear() overridemc2lib::memconsistency::cats::ArchProxy< ConcreteArch >inlinevirtual
EventTypeRead() const overridemc2lib::memconsistency::cats::ArchProxy< ConcreteArch >inlinevirtual
EventTypeWrite() const overridemc2lib::memconsistency::cats::ArchProxy< ConcreteArch >inlinevirtual
fences(const ExecWitness &ew) const overridemc2lib::memconsistency::cats::ArchProxy< ConcreteArch >inlinevirtual
fences_mc2lib::memconsistency::cats::ArchProxy< ConcreteArch >protected
hb(const ExecWitness &ew) const overridemc2lib::memconsistency::cats::ArchProxy< ConcreteArch >inlinevirtual
hb_mc2lib::memconsistency::cats::ArchProxy< ConcreteArch >protected
MakeChecker(const Architecture *arch, const ExecWitness *exec) const overridemc2lib::memconsistency::cats::ArchProxy< ConcreteArch >inlinevirtual
MakeChecker(const ExecWitness *exec) constmc2lib::memconsistency::cats::ArchProxy< ConcreteArch >inline
Memoize(const ExecWitness &ew)mc2lib::memconsistency::cats::ArchProxy< ConcreteArch >inline
memoized_fences_mc2lib::memconsistency::cats::ArchProxy< ConcreteArch >protected
memoized_hb_mc2lib::memconsistency::cats::ArchProxy< ConcreteArch >protected
memoized_ppo_mc2lib::memconsistency::cats::ArchProxy< ConcreteArch >protected
memoized_prop_mc2lib::memconsistency::cats::ArchProxy< ConcreteArch >protected
ppo(const ExecWitness &ew) const overridemc2lib::memconsistency::cats::ArchProxy< ConcreteArch >inlinevirtual
ppo_mc2lib::memconsistency::cats::ArchProxy< ConcreteArch >protected
prop(const ExecWitness &ew) const overridemc2lib::memconsistency::cats::ArchProxy< ConcreteArch >inlinevirtual
prop_mc2lib::memconsistency::cats::ArchProxy< ConcreteArch >protected
proxy_mc2lib::memconsistency::cats::Architectureprotected
set_proxy(const Architecture *proxy)mc2lib::memconsistency::cats::Architectureinline
~Architecture()mc2lib::memconsistency::cats::Architectureinlinevirtual
~ArchProxy() overridemc2lib::memconsistency::cats::ArchProxy< ConcreteArch >inline